1 When a man shall take a wife and he married her, and it was if she shall find not favor in his eyes because he found in her a nakedness of the word: and he wrote for her a writing of cutting off, and gave in her hand, and sent her away from his house.

2 And she shall go out of his house, and go and was to another man.

3 And the last man hated her and wrote for her a writing of cutting off, and gave in her hand, and sent her away from his house; or if the last man shall die which took her to him for a wife,

4 Her first husband who sent her away shall not be able to turn back to take her to be to him for a wife after that she was defiled; for it is an abomination before Jehovah: and thou shalt not cause the land to sin which Jehovah thy God gave to thee an inheritance.

5 When a man shall take a new wife, he shall not go out in the war, and nothing shall pass upon him for any word: he shall be free to his house one year, and gladden his wife whom he took.

6 He shall not take the two mill-stones as a pledge, and the rider, for it is taking the soul as a pledge.

7 If a man shall be found stealing a soul from his brethren from the sons of Israel, and shall lay hands upon him and sell him; and that thief died; and put thou away evil from the midst of thee.

8 Watch in the stroke of leprosy to watch greatly, and to do according to all that the priests the Levites shall teach you: as I commanded them ye shall watch to do.

9 Remember what Jehovah thy God did to Miriam in the way, in your coming out of Egypt.

10 When thou shalt lend to thy friend the loan of any thing, thou shalt not go to his house to exchange his pledge:

11 Thou shalt stand without, and the man to whom was lent to him, shall bring out to thee the pledge without.

12 And if the man be poor, he shall not sleep with his pledge.

13 Turning back, thou shalt turn back to him the pledge as the sun went down; he lay down in his garment and blessed thee; and to thee shall be justice before Jehovah thy God.

Deuteronomy 24:1-13, Smith's Literal Translation. Public domain.
